Output 85dc15920660843ee9677561944733608562d143c54045154204fa618ad1975e:1

value
3421600
script pubkey
OP_0 OP_PUSHBYTES_20 66fd64eeac5202dfffff58b4c75ef4baba668222
address
bc1qvm7kfm4v2gpdlllltz6vwhh5h2axdq3z0qp9xu
transaction
85dc15920660843ee9677561944733608562d143c54045154204fa618ad1975e
spent
true